[Bug 1910657] [NEW] FTBFS with -O3 on ppc64el

2021-01-07 Thread Logan Rosen
Public bug reported:

w1retap FTBFS with -O3 on ppc64el:
https://launchpad.net/ubuntu/+source/w1retap/1.4.4-4ubuntu1/+build/20784039

I've uploaded a version that uses -O2 instead, but we should look into
why there's a failure with -O3 so that we can avoid that workaround.

Relevant log snippet:

gcc -DHAVE_CONFIG_H -I. -I../..  -Wall -D_GNU_SOURCE=1 -I . -pthread 
-I/usr/include/glib-2.0 -I/usr/lib/powerpc64le-linux-gnu/glib-2.0/include  
-Wdate-time -D_FORTIFY_SOURCE=2 -Werror -Wno-unused-result  -g -O3 
-fdebug-prefix-map=/<>=. -fstack-protector-strong -Wformat 
-Werror=format-security -Wall -c -o owprgm.o owprgm.c
gcc -DHAVE_CONFIG_H -I. -I../..  -Wall -D_GNU_SOURCE=1 -I . -pthread 
-I/usr/include/glib-2.0 -I/usr/lib/powerpc64le-linux-gnu/glib-2.0/include  
-Wdate-time -D_FORTIFY_SOURCE=2 -Werror -Wno-unused-result  -g -O3 
-fdebug-prefix-map=/<>=. -fstack-protector-strong -Wformat 
-Werror=format-security -Wall -c -o owcache.o owcache.c
gcc -DHAVE_CONFIG_H -I. -I../..  -Wall -D_GNU_SOURCE=1 -I . -pthread 
-I/usr/include/glib-2.0 -I/usr/lib/powerpc64le-linux-gnu/glib-2.0/include  
-Wdate-time -D_FORTIFY_SOURCE=2 -Werror -Wno-unused-result  -g -O3 
-fdebug-prefix-map=/<>=. -fstack-protector-strong -Wformat 
-Werror=format-security -Wall -c -o temp10.o temp10.c
owprgm.c: In function ‘setJobData’:
owprgm.c:816:28: error: writing 1 byte into a region of size 0 
[-Werror=stringop-overflow=]
  816 |   job.Page[pg].data[i] = buff[i];
  |   ~^
In file included from owprgm.c:33:
owfile.h:115:17: note: at offset [29, 30] to object ‘data’ with size 29 
declared here
  115 |   uchar data[29];  // data to write
  | ^~~~
owprgm.c:816:28: error: writing 1 byte into a region of size 0 
[-Werror=stringop-overflow=]
  816 |   job.Page[pg].data[i] = buff[i];
  |   ~^
In file included from owprgm.c:33:
owfile.h:115:17: note: at offset 30 to object ‘data’ with size 29 declared here
  115 |   uchar data[29];  // data to write
  | ^~~~
owfile.c: In function ‘owOpenFile’:
owfile.c:1271:16: note: the layout of aggregates containing vectors with 1-byte 
alignment has changed in GCC 5
 1271 |Han[hn].Ext = flname->Ext & 0x7F;
  |^~~~
gcc -DHAVE_CONFIG_H -I. -I../..  -Wall -D_GNU_SOURCE=1 -I . -pthread 
-I/usr/include/glib-2.0 -I/usr/lib/powerpc64le-linux-gnu/glib-2.0/include  
-Wdate-time -D_FORTIFY_SOURCE=2 -Werror -Wno-unused-result  -g -O3 
-fdebug-prefix-map=/<>=. -fstack-protector-strong -Wformat 
-Werror=format-security -Wall -c -o atod26.o atod26.c
cc1: all warnings being treated as errors
make[5]: *** [Makefile:926: owprgm.o] Error 1

[Bug 1910639] [NEW] DMI entry syntax fix for Pegatron / ByteSpeed C15B

2021-01-07 Thread Po-Hsu Lin
Public bug reported:

[Impact]
Upstream reports that when compiling the kernel with a48491c65b51 ("Input: 
i8042 - add ByteSpeed touchpad to noloop table"), g++ will complain about:
drivers/input/serio/i8042-x86ia64io.h:225:3: error: ‘.matches’ designator 
used multiple times in the same initializer list

C99 semantics is that last duplicated initialiser wins,
so DMI entry gets overwritten.

[Fix]
* a3a9060ecad030 ("Input: i8042 - unbreak Pegatron C15B")

This can be cherry-picked into all the affected series.

[Test]
I didn't get this error while building the test kernel for bug 1906128
So the only thing that I can test is to build them again and make sure there is 
no other issues.

[Where problems could occur]
If this fix is incorrect it might affect the touchpad support on Pegatron / 
ByteSpeed C15B laptop.
Build the kernel

[Bug 1910537] Re: incorrect audio-EDID on HDMI, blocking audio transmission over HDMI

2021-01-07 Thread Daniel van Vugt
> Their guess is that the linux notebook is not setting EDID
> configuration correctly and thus not recognized by the ATEM,
> while the cheap LCD screen propably does not care about EDID
> and just plays everything, therefore a wrong EDID information
> would not matter.

EDIDs work the other way round. An EDID is not "set" by Linux. It is
hard-coded in the monitor and only read by the computer. However it is
sadly common for monitor manufacturers (probably not Blackmagic) to ship
monitors that advertise faulty EDID data. That's probably what an "EDID
manager" is to fix, but I don't know of and have no experience with any
on Linux.

I would like to analyse the EDID being advertised by your ATEM, but
Xrandr.txt seems to show it was not plugged into HDMI when you logged
this bug. Please plug it in and then run:

  xrandr --verbose > xrandr2.txt

and attach the resulting file here.

[Bug 1910611] Re: sssd startup fails when apparmor in enforcing mode

2021-01-07 Thread Seth Arnold
Hello Richard, it looks like the profile may not have kept up with
changes in the packaging.

The profile has probably been broken ever since:

sssd (2.2.0-1) unstable; urgency=medium

  * New upstream release.
  * control: Bump policy to 4.4.0.
  * control, compat, rules: Bump debhelper to 12.
  * *.install: Updated, some files moved to /usr/libexec.

 -- Timo Aaltonen   Wed, 10 Jul 2019 10:14:09 +0300

Please try adding this line:

  /usr/libexec/sssd/* rmix,

to the file:

/etc/apparmor.d/local/usr.sbin.sssd

Then, try:

sudo apparmor_parser --replace /etc/apparmor.d/usr.sbin.sssd
sudo systemctl restart sssd

Please report back how well this works.

Thanks

[Bug 1910618] [NEW] bcmwl 6.30.223.271+bdcom build fails with kernel 5.8.0-34

2021-01-07 Thread Paul Wilson
Public bug reported:

Ubuntu 20.04.1 LTS
bcmwl-kernel-source_6.30.223.271


I believe the important part of the 
/var/lib/dkms/bcmwl/6.30.223.271+bdcom/build/make.log is below.

/var/lib/dkms/bcmwl/6.30.223.271+bdcom/build/src/wl/sys/wl_linux.c: In function 
‘wl_reg_proc_entry’:
/var/lib/dkms/bcmwl/6.30.223.271+bdcom/build/src/wl/sys/wl_linux.c:3376:58: 
error: passing argument 4 of ‘proc_create_data’ from incompatible pointe
r type [-Werror=incompatible-pointer-types]
 3376 |  if ((wl->proc_entry = proc_create_data(tmp, 0644, NULL, &wl_fops, wl)) 
== NULL) {
  |  ^~~~
  |  |
  |  const struct 
file_operations *
In file included from 
/var/lib/dkms/bcmwl/6.30.223.271+bdcom/build/src/wl/sys/wl_linux.c:38:
./include/linux/proc_fs.h:102:31: note: expected ‘const struct proc_ops *’ but 
argument is of type ‘const struct file_operations *’
  102 | extern struct proc_dir_entry *proc_create_data(const char *, umode_t,
  |   ^~~~


It looks like 
/var/lib/dkms/bcmwl/6.30.223.271+bdcom/build/src/wl/sys/wl_linux.c uses the 
file_operations structure.

lines 3359-3381 from wl_linux.c

#if LINUX_VERSION_CODE >= KERNEL_VERSION(3, 10, 0)
static const struct file_operations wl_fops = {
.owner  = THIS_MODULE,
.read   = wl_proc_read,
.write  = wl_proc_write,
};
#endif

static int
wl_reg_proc_entry(wl_info_t *wl)
{
char tmp[32];
sprintf(tmp, "%s%d", HYBRID_PROC, wl->pub->unit);
#if LINUX_VERSION_CODE < KERNEL_VERSION(3, 10, 0)
if ((wl->proc_entry = create_proc_entry(tmp, 0644, NULL)) == NULL) {
WL_ERROR(("%s: create_proc_entry %s failed\n", __FUNCTION__, 
tmp));
#else
if ((wl->proc_entry = proc_create_data(tmp, 0644, NULL, &wl_fops, wl)) 
== NULL) {
WL_ERROR(("%s: proc_create_data %s failed\n", __FUNCTION__, 
tmp));
#endif
ASSERT(0);
return -1;
}


However, it looks like proc_fs.h uses a different structure (proc_ops).

/usr/src/linux-headers-5.8.0-34-generic/include/linux/proc_fs.h
/usr/src/linux-hwe-5.8-headers-5.8.0-34/include/linux/proc_fs.h

kernel 5.8.0-34
proc_fs.h
lines 29-43 

struct proc_ops {
unsigned int proc_flags;
int (*proc_open)(struct inode *, struct file *);
ssize_t (*proc_read)(struct file *, char __user *, size_t, loff_t *);
ssize_t (*proc_write)(struct file *, const char __user *, size_t, 
loff_t *);
loff_t  (*proc_lseek)(struct file *, loff_t, int);
int (*proc_release)(struct inode *, struct file *);
__poll_t (*proc_poll)(struct file *, struct poll_table_struct *);
long(*proc_ioctl)(struct file *, unsigned int, unsigned long);
#ifdef CONFIG_COMPAT
long(*proc_compat_ioctl)(struct file *, unsigned int, unsigned 
long);
#endif
int (*proc_mmap)(struct file *, struct vm_area_struct *);
unsigned long (*proc_get_unmapped_area)(struct file *, unsigned long, 
unsigned long, unsigned long, unsigned long);
} __randomize_layout;

and lines 102-107

extern struct proc_dir_entry *proc_create_data(const char *, umode_t,
   struct proc_dir_entry *,
   const struct proc_ops *,
   void *);

struct proc_dir_entry *proc_create(const char *name, umode_t mode,
struct proc_dir_entry *parent, const struct proc_ops *proc_ops);


Looking back at the linux 5.4.0-59 headers, proc_fs.h appears to use the 
file_operations structure.

/usr/src/linux-headers-5.4.0-59-generic/include/linux/proc_fs.h
/usr/src/linux-headers-5.4.0-59/include/linux/proc_fs.h

kernel 5.4.0-59
proc_fs.h
lines 44-49

extern struct proc_dir_entry *proc_create_data(const char *, umode_t,
   struct proc_dir_entry *,
   const struct file_operations *,
   void *);

struct proc_dir_entry *proc_create(const char *name, umode_t mode,
struct proc_dir_entry *parent, const struct file_operations *proc_fops);


If this is where the problem lies, I am guessing it is better to try to fix the 
Broadcom package/ wl_linux.c than the Linux 5.8.0-34 headers?
